The crawl archive for April 2016 is now available! More than 1.33 billion webpages are in the archive, which islocated in the commoncrawl bucket at crawl-data/CC-MAIN-2016-18/.

By simply adding either s3://commoncrawl/ or https://data.commoncrawl.org/ to each line, you end up with the S3 and HTTP paths respectively.

The Common Crawl URL Index for this crawl is available at: https://index.commoncrawl.org/CC-MAIN-2016-18/.

For more information on working with the URL index, please refer to the previous blog post or the Index Server API. There is also a command-line tool client for common use cases of the url index.

Note that the April crawl is based on the same URL seed list as the preceding crawl of February 2016. However, the manner in which the crawler follows redirects is changed: redirects are not followed immediately; instead redirect targets from the current crawl are recorded and followed by the subsequent crawl. This approach serves to avoid duplicates with exactly the same URL contained in multiple segments (e.g., one of the commoncrawl.org pages). The February crawl contains almost 10% such duplicates.
